[Botulinum toxin injections under electromyographic guidance].

Abstract
EMG can be used for both dystonic muscles selection and performing injections of botulinum toxin. The indications for performing injections under EMG guidance in different forms of movement disorders are discussed. There is no need of EMG control in the treatment of blepharospasm and hemifacial spasm. In cervical dystonia the use of EMG guidance can improve the results of treatment in cases of head tilt, retrocollis, shoulder elevation and in more complex forms of dystonia. The injections should be performed under EMG control in patients with limb, oro-mandibular and laryngeal dystonia and with palatal myoclonus.
